There was a cover charge of $10 per person on Saturday night. Went with friends to watch the live band 'Flip District'. The band was really good and kept the party abuzz thru the night. We made table reservations thru OpenTable which was convenient. The hostess was aware of the reservation and had us seated immediately. The staff was very efficient with food and drink orders, inspite of the packed restaurant. They continued to check in on refills. The place is ideal for dancing & partying and not great if you want to catch up with friends for a chat. Pricing : Moderate high

Ask the Community - Sambuca 360

How much is cover charge on Friday night?

It was $10 cover fee when we went

18+ or 21+?

After 9 p.m. yes, 21 and older!

When does the band start on Friday?

9:30
